Pump Shotgun

A shotgun with a manually operated sliding action that loads shells into the chamber. Known for its reliability and power at short range, it is often used in hunting, law enforcement, and combat.

Semi-Automatic Shotgun

Semi-automatic and automatic shotguns have a rich history and niche role in military, law enforcement, and civilian applications. Semi-automatic shotguns, which automatically chamber the next round after each shot, became popular in the early 20th century for both hunting and combat, with models like the Browning Auto-5 setting a standard for reliability. These firearms gained favor in military and police units for riot control and close-quarters combat due to their ability to deliver rapid, controlled firepower.
